Mustaqil ish Topshirdi: Haydarniyozov A. Qabul qildi: Ulashev A. Reja: 1. Zusullariamonaviy shifrlash usulari 2. Kod 3. Shefirlashning Tarixi 1. Zamonaviy shifrlash usullarini ikkita mezon bo'yicha ajratish mumkin: ishlatiladigan kalit turiga va kirish ma'lumotlarining turiga qarab. Kalit turi bo'yicha ishlatiladigan shifrlar quyidagilarga bo'linadi: Nosimmetrik kalit algoritmida (masalan, DES va AES ), jo'natuvchi va qabul qiluvchida oldindan o'rnatilgan va boshqa barcha tomonlardan sir saqlanadigan umumiy kalit bo'lishi kerak; jo'natuvchi ushbu kalitdan shifrlash uchun, qabul qiluvchi esa shifrdan chiqarish uchun xuddi shu kalitdan foydalanadi. The Feystel shifri almashtirish va transpozitsiya usullarining kombinatsiyasidan foydalanadi. Bloklarni shifrlash algoritmlarining aksariyati ushbu tuzilishga asoslangan. Asimmetrik kalit algoritmida (masalan, RSA ), ikkita alohida tugma mavjud: a ochiq kalit nashr etiladi va har qanday jo'natuvchiga shifrlashni amalga oshirishi mumkin, a shaxsiy kalit qabul qiluvchida sir saqlanadi va faqat o'sha kishiga to'g'ri parolini ochish imkoniyatini beradi. Shifrlarni kirish ma'lumotlarining turi bo'yicha ikki turga ajratish mumkin: blok shifrlari, aniq o'lchamdagi ma'lumotlar blokini shifrlaydigan va oqim shifrlari, uzluksiz ma'lumot oqimlarini shifrlaydigan. 2. Texnik bo'lmagan foydalanishda "(sir) kod "odatda" shifr "degan ma'noni anglatadi. Ammo texnik munozaralarda" kod "va" shifr "so'zlari ikki xil tushunchani anglatadi. Kodlar ma'no darajasida ishlaydi, ya'ni so'zlar yoki iboralar boshqa narsaga aylantiriladi va bu chunking odatda xabarni qisqartiradi. Tarixiy jihatdan kriptografiya kodlar va shifrlarning dixotomiyasiga bo'lingan; va kodlash o'z terminologiyasiga ega edi, shunga o'xshash shifrlar uchun: "kodlash, kodeks, dekodlash" va hokazo. 3. Ilgari ishlatilgan tarixiy qalam va qog'oz shifrlari ba'zida shunday nomlanadi klassik shifrlar. Ular oddiy almashtirish shifrlari (kabi ROT13 ) va transpozitsiya shifrlari (masalan, a Temir yo'l to'siqlarini shifrlash ). Masalan, "GOOD DOG" "PLLX XLP" sifatida shifrlanishi mumkin, bu erda "L" "O" o'rniga, "P" "G" ga va "X" "D" ga almashtiriladi. "GOOD DOG" harflarining o'tkazilishi "DGOGDOO" ga olib kelishi mumkin. Ushbu oddiy shifrlar va misollarni yorib olish oson, hatto oddiy matnli shifrlangan juftliklarsiz ham Oddiy shifrlar bilan almashtirildi polyalphabetic substitution shifrlari (masalan Vigenere ) har bir harf uchun almashtirish alifbosini o'zgartirgan. Masalan, "GOOD DOG" "PLSX TWF" sifatida shifrlanishi mumkin, bu erda "L", "S" va "W" "O" o'rnini bosadi. Hatto ma'lum miqdordagi yoki taxmin qilingan oddiy matnli oddiy qalam va qog'ozni shifrlash uchun mo'ljallangan oddiy polifalitik o'rnini bosuvchi shifrlar va harflarni ko'chirish shifrlari yorilib ketishi oson.[5] A asosida ishonchli qalam va qog'oz shifrini yaratish mumkin bir martalik pad bo'lsa-da, lekin bir martalik yostiqlarning odatiy kamchiliklari murojaat qilish. Yigirmanchi asrning boshlarida transpozitsiya, polifalfik o'rnini bosish va o'ziga xos "qo'shimchalar" o'rnini bosish yordamida shifrlash va parolni echish uchun elektromekanik mashinalar ixtiro qilindi. Yilda rotorli mashinalar, bir nechta rotorli disklar polifalitik almashtirishni ta'minladi, vilkalar plitalari esa boshqa almashtirishni ta'minladilar. Rotor disklari va plita simlarini almashtirish orqali kalitlarni osongina o'zgartirish mumkin edi. Ushbu shifrlash usullari avvalgi sxemalarga qaraganda ancha murakkab bo'lganligi va shifrlash va parolini ochish uchun mashinalarni talab qilganiga qaramay, boshqa mashinalar, masalan, inglizlar Bomba ushbu shifrlash usullarini buzish uchun ixtiro qilingan.
Do'stlaringiz bilan baham: |